Subject: DR drill — reset flow cutover

During Tuesday's drill, the revamped Wrenfold password reset flow fails over to the Dunmarsh standby. On-call should verify token issuance resumes within five minutes and confirm the old flow stays disabled. If the standby console requires re-authentication during cutover, enter the recovery passphrase below.

unlock words, tawif-tahop: oliys-ulawyn-tamdor-lamys-casox-jormir-fraius-kasath-ulador-ulamir-holir-sorys-holeth

## Further Reading

All SQL files in the Quillbrook repo are checked by our custom linter, sqlward, before merge. The rules cover keyword casing, mandatory table aliases, explicit JOIN conditions, and a ban on SELECT * outside of throwaway scripts. New team members should read the rule rationale carefully, since several rules exist because of past incidents rather than style preference alone. Exceptions require a comment pragma and reviewer sign-off. The full rule catalog, with examples and exemption procedures, lives on our internal wiki page.

runbook for badug-kadup: https://confluence.zemvarlabs.internal/projects/browse/display/projects/bd1b

Handover note — fan-out backpressure

Quick heads-up for on-call: the Drumlin notifier is still touchy when fan-out queues exceed 50k. I bumped the shed-load threshold Friday; watch the consumer lag dashboard over the weekend. If it wedges, restart the dispatcher pods one at a time. Anything gnarlier, page the backpressure workstream owner, named below.

account owner for bawip-tahag: Raleth Quenok

Subject: Handover — Penника receipts mailer

Taking over Givewick donation-receipt mailer releases from me as of Friday. Pipeline is green, v1.9 shipped Tuesday, nothing pending. Only gotcha: the mailer templates are signed separately from the app bundle, and staging won't accept unsigned templates. Everything else is in the runbook. For signing the next template release, use the key below.

release key, fajop-fahof: bky19_e81kW8mKnKvqQ6eSnkx